Stamped Concrete Sealing in Puyallup, WA
Stamped concrete sealing services involve applying a protective coating to stamped concrete surfaces to enhance durability and maintain their appearance. This process is commonly used on driveways, patios, walkways, and pool decks to preserve the intricate patterns and colors of stamped concrete while providing resistance against stains, moisture, and surface wear. Homeowners often seek sealing services to extend the lifespan of their decorative concrete, prevent damage from weather and foot traffic, and keep the surface looking its best over time. Before requesting sealing, property owners should consider the current condition of the concrete, whether it has been previously sealed, and the type of finish desired to ensure the best results.
Understanding the different sealing options is important for property owners considering this service. Some may prefer a high-gloss finish for a vibrant appearance, while others might opt for a matte look for a more subdued effect. It's also useful to know that sealing typically needs to be reapplied periodically to maintain protection and appearance. Homeowners should inquire about the appropriate type of sealer for their specific project, the preparation process involved, and any necessary aftercare to keep their stamped concrete surfaces in optimal condition.

Common Stamped Concrete Sealing Jobs
Stamped concrete patios - sealing helps protect decorative surfaces from staining and weather damage.
Driveway surfaces - sealing extends the lifespan of stamped concrete driveways by preventing cracks and deterioration.
Walkways and pathways - applying sealant enhances durability and maintains the appearance of stamped concrete paths.
Pool decks - sealing provides a protective barrier against water penetration and surface wear.
Garage floors - sealing helps resist oil stains and surface abrasion on stamped concrete garage areas.
Outdoor entertainment areas - sealing preserves the vibrancy and integrity of stamped concrete features over time.
Stamped Concrete Sealing Questions
What is stamped concrete sealing? Stamped concrete sealing involves applying a protective coating to enhance durability and preserve the appearance of stamped concrete surfaces.
Why is sealing stamped concrete important? Sealing helps prevent damage from stains, moisture, and wear, extending the lifespan of the decorative surface.
What surfaces typically require sealing? Driveways, patios, walkways, and pool decks with stamped concrete benefit most from sealing services.
How often should stamped concrete be sealed? Sealing is generally rec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ain appearance and protection.
